Plans are underway to run a Vande Bharat Express from Purnia to Patna, benefiting 7 districts of the Seemanchal region. The Railway Minister has directed a technical feasibility study.
Bihar Vande Bharat: There's good news for lakhs of people in Seemanchal, including Purnia. They will soon be able to travel to Patna quickly and comfortably via the Vande Bharat Express. The Railway Ministry has begun working on the possibility of running a Vande Bharat Express from Purnia to Patna.
Railway Minister Approves Operational Feasibility Study
Railway Minister Ashwini Vaishnaw has seriously considered this proposal and directed the relevant railway officials to conduct an operational feasibility study, examining the technical and practical possibilities. The proposed route for this train will be from Jogbani to Purnia Court, Saharsa, Simri Bakhtiarpur, and then to Patna. This route will directly connect several districts of Seemanchal to the state capital.
Success for Leshi Singh's Efforts
Leshi Singh, Bihar Government's Minister of Food and Consumer Protection, has consistently worked towards this important rail service. She stated that on September 26, 2024, she met with the Railway Minister and requested the introduction of a Vande Bharat Express from Purnia. Additionally, she requested a halt for the Janhit Express at Sarsi station, which was approved on January 28, 2025.
Repeated Initiatives Led to Recognition
Minister Leshi Singh reiterated this request by writing letters to the Railway Minister again on February 19, 2025, and July 30, 2025. Finally, on August 6, 2025, she received a letter from the Railway Ministry confirming that officials had been directed to conduct an operational feasibility study.
Seven Districts to Benefit Directly
The proposed Vande Bharat service will benefit Purnia, as well as Saharsa, Supaul, Madhepura, Araria, Kishanganj, and Khagaria districts. Currently, traveling from these districts to Patna is time-consuming and inconvenient. The introduction of the Vande Bharat will reduce travel time by several hours and make it more comfortable.

Currently, One Has to Go to Katihar to Catch the Vande Bharat
Currently, people from Seemanchal have to go to Katihar to catch the Vande Bharat Express to Patna. This increases both travel time and expense. If the Vande Bharat starts from Purnia, it will provide great relief to the local people.
